DECISION & ORDER ON APPLICATION

Application by defendant for leave to reargue his prior application pursuant to CPL 450.15 and 460.15 for a certificate granting leave to appeal to this court from an order of the Criminal Court of the City of New York, Kings County, entered April 7, 2011, which was denied by decision and order on application dated September 6, 2011.

Upon the papers filed in support of the application and no papers having been filed in opposition thereto, it is

ORDERED that the application is granted and defendant is granted leave to appeal from the order of the Criminal Court of the City of New York, Kings County, entered April 7, 2011; and it is further,

CERTIFIED that said order involves questions of law or fact which ought to be reviewed by the Appellate Term, Second, Eleventh and Thirteenth Judicial Districts; and it is further,

ORDERED that the papers which accompanied this application are deemed to be a timely notice of appeal from said order.
